Slovenia becomes latest EU country to recognize Palestinian state

JUBLJANA, SLOVENIA — Slovenia became the latest European Union country to recognize an independent Palestinian state after its parliament approved the move with a majority vote on Tuesday, dismissing a call for a referendum on the issue by the largest opposition party. The government last week decided to recognize Palestine as an independent and sovereign state following in the steps of Spain, Ireland and Norway as part of a wider effort to coordinate pressure on Israel to end the conflict in Gaza. \"Today\'s recognition of Palestine as a sovereign and independent state sends hope to the Palestinian people in the West Bank and in Gaza,\" Prime Minister Robert Golob said on X. The vote was scheduled for Tuesday, and a parliamentary group for foreign affairs on Monday endorsed the government decision with a majority vote.
